90 Day Fiancé Star Chuck Potthast Dies at 64

Chuck Potthast, the father of 90 Day Fiancé star Elizabeth Castravet, has died at the age of 64. The news was confirmed by Elizabeth in a social media post, where she described the loss as a tragedy that has left the family “completely shattered.”

“My sweet, loving, and caring dad went to heaven,” Elizabeth wrote on Instagram alongside a family photo. She asked for privacy during this difficult time. The cause of death has not been disclosed.

Potthast was a familiar face on the TLC reality series, often appearing as a supportive father to Elizabeth during her relationship with husband Andrei Castravet. He frequently helped the couple navigate financial and cultural challenges as Andrei adapted to life in the United States.

In a 2022 episode of 90 Day Diaries, Potthast revealed he had been diagnosed with bladder cancer in 2016, which resulted in the removal of his bladder and the use of a urine pouch. He later shared a health update in September from his hospital bed, explaining that surgery to repair hernias from previous cancer operations had taken longer than expected due to a collapsed stomach wall.

Potthast’s daughter Becky also paid tribute on Instagram, writing that her father had “gone home to be with The Lord” two weeks prior. Fans and friends have expressed condolences, remembering Potthast as a kind, supportive father and a beloved figure on the show.
